Bolton is a full-service employee benefits, actuarial, investment and compensation consulting firm with nine offices across the US. Bolton has a 40-year history of consulting to clients in the Public and Corporate Sectors, Nonprofit Organizations, as well as for the Federal Government. Bolton Rewards helps clients build and optimize their people resources through their reward strategy, compensation program design and rewards communication. We are currently looking to add a talented and motivated professional to our Rewards practice as a Data/Compensation Analyst. Our Analysts work with project leaders to meet project demands and complete several important projects and tasks:
- Perform market sector and financial research
- Collect, clean, compile, and analyze employee, job, market and other research data
- Source research materials and compensation surveys
- Develop cash compensation market rates – market benchmarking
- Model of various types of base pay programs and pay structures
- Draft and customize pre-existing exhibits and reports using Microsoft Excel and Access (SQL)
- Participate as needed in client delivery meetings
